    A HUNDRED years ago, Private Charles Harness was killed in action.

    Private Charles Peire Harness of High Street, Aveley, served with the 4th Btn.

    The Royal Fusiliers were amongst the first troops to be sent to Belgium at the outbreak of WW1.

    Charles was reported MISSING presumed Killed In Action during ‘The Battle of the Marne’ on the 26th September 1914.

    Charles is commemorated on the Memorial at LA FERTE-SOUS-JOUARRE in France.
